Extruder multiple-screw operation

It is also possible (as mentioned earlier) to have extruders that use twin or multiple screws. Such extruders are utilized in certain operations because they offer specific advantages. These include (1) increased output at low screw speed, (2) improved pumping control over a wide range of operating conditions, (3) decreased viscous dissipation and internal heat generation, (4) ability to handle materials that are difficult to feed, and (5) lower power requirements (see Fig. 7-9). [Pg.291]

Solids feeders are composed of single or multiple screws that rotate inside a sleeve. Granules and additives from the feed and additive tanks are conveyed to the homogenizer by the feeders. Most solids feeders are single screws that deliver solids at a specific rate. Granules leave the feed tank continuously when the extruder is in operation. Figure 10-13 illustrates how a solids feeder operates. [Pg.239]

Screw extruders are also used, however, to produce pelleted materials, either as a final product or for further processing, in the food, ceramics, chemical and other industries. Many orifices in a die plate form a multiplicity of extruded rods which are cut into pellets by rotary cutter blades. The extrusion operation is frequently the final step in a sequence of processes which may include binder/lubricant addition, mixing, heating, cooling or vacuum degassing. [Pg.117]

For the tests of preparing dynamic vulcanizates in the continuous process of reactive extrusion a twin-screw mixer-extruder DSK 42/6D manufactured by Brabender was used. The vulcanizates were produced dynamically in the process of one-stage or two-stage extrusion process, setting the favorable operating parameters for the device, which had been determined based on multiple tests distribution of temperatures in each heating area... [Pg.49]
